Nature Mills Garlic Vadam recalled for undeclared wheat allergen

NatureMills US Incorporated is recalling Nature Mills Garlic Vadam due to undeclared wheat allergens. The product was distributed via the company's website.

Plain-English summary

Nature Mills Garlic Vadam, 100g, is being recalled by NatureMills US Incorporated due to the presence of undeclared wheat allergens.

The product was distributed throughout the United States via the company's website. The recall affects a total of 6,712 units. Affected products carry the following lot codes: GVMIXG (Best By OCT-2025), GVMXIIG (Best By JAN-2026), and GVMVH (Best By JUN-2026).

Consumers with wheat allergies or sensitivities are at risk if they consume this product. Those who have purchased this product should not consume it and should return it to the place of purchase or dispose of it. Anyone who has already consumed the product and experienced allergic symptoms should contact their healthcare provider.
